区块链钱包开发:如何确保安全性不被忽视

            区块链钱包的兴起

            现在,大家应该对区块链钱包这种东西不陌生了吧?说白了,它就是用来存储和管理加密货币的工具。随着加密货币的流行,区块链钱包的开发需求也越来越大。每个人都想有一个安全可靠的钱包来保存自己的数字资产。想象一下,如果钱包被黑客攻击,那可真是一场噩梦!

            开发区块链钱包的类型

            在我们聊安全性之前,首先了解一下区块链钱包的类型吧。一般来说,钱包可以分为热钱包和冷钱包。热钱包是在线的,经常会用于日常交易,像你手机上的APP。冷钱包则是离线存储,比如硬件设备。热钱包方便,但风险相对较高;冷钱包安全,但使用起来麻烦一些。

            安全性的重要性

            安全性在区块链钱包开发中真的是个大课题。你得知道,大部分的黑客攻击并不是源于技术,而是源于人的失误。很多人都是一时的疏忽,导致了资金的损失。所以,在开发钱包的时候,安全性绝对不能马虎。我们要设计出让用户觉得放心的钱包,不光是为了保护他们的资产,更是为了整个生态的健康。

            加密技术的应用

            加密技术是保障钱包安全的核心。在开发的时候,得用到AES、RSA等高级加密算法。这些算法可以确保用户的数据在传输过程中的隐私性。用户的私钥绝对不能以明文形式存储。要用加密的方式保护起来,就算黑客攻进来了,也没办法直接获取到这些信息。

            私钥管理

            谈到私钥,不得不说这是区块链钱包的“命脉”。一旦私钥泄露,别说你的虚拟货币,连你的心情都要跟着缩水。开发时,要考虑到私钥的生成和存储策略,要确保私钥是在用户本地生成的,并且存储在安全的地方。有些高端钱包甚至会使用HSM硬件安全模块来存储私钥,安全性简直就上了一个台阶。

            双因素认证

            双因素认证也是提升安全性的好方法。加点复杂性其实并不坏。用户在登录钱包的时候,不仅要输入密码,还得进行验证,像短信验证码或者动态令牌。在这一步,安全性又上了一层楼。有的时候,黑客即便获取了用户的密码,但没有第二个认证手段,也就无能为力了。

            及时更新和监控

            安全不是一劳永逸的事情,开发者要随时关注安全动态,及时更新钱包的安全协议和算法。这时候,监控就显得特别重要了。通过监控系统,能够实时发现异常交易,及时拦截潜在风险。这种“守夜人”式的存在,让人的钱包更有保障。

            用户教育的重要性

            归根结底,安全问题不仅仅在于技术,更在于用户的安全意识。开发者应该为用户提供详细的说明和指南,让他们知道如何安全使用钱包。在注册、转账等环节,同样需要给出清晰的提示。就像教小朋友如何过马路,要眼明手快,才能安全到达。

            总结:钱包的未来与安全

            区块链钱包的未来一定是光明的,但安全性却始终是一个不可忽视的话题。作为开发者,得时刻在安全的道路上持续探索和创新。无论技术如何发展,保护用户的资产安全始终是我们义不容辞的责任。你觉得呢?

                  author

                  Appnox App

                  content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                      related post

                                                leave a reply